自动控制网移动版

自动控制网 > 基础知识 > 智能控制 >

免疫算法的设计方法和参数选择

1.免疫算法的主要设计方法
    (1) 白箱模拟法
    按照白箱模拟法的思路,借用生物免疫机制的一些概念,从形式上进行一定的模拟,以实现对系统人工免疫的目的。
    (2) 黑箱模拟法
     黑箱模拟法间接地从输入输出的特征来考察人工系统对自然系统的模拟。免疫算法常采用遗传算法或进化算法对外界攻击或病毒进行学习,产生出与外界攻击或者病毒相克的抗体。所以,免疫算法一般采用了遗传学习机制。

2.免疫算法的参数
    不同免疫算法的分析和比较主要从以下两个方面进行研究:
    (1) 自然免疫系统的免疫学理论和方法;
    (2) 计算机算法的分析量度。
    免疫算法的种类
    (1) 反向选择算法
    (2) 免疫遗传算法
    (3) 克隆选择算法
    (4) 基于疫苗的免疫算法
    (5) 基于免疫网络的免疫算法
    免疫算法的参数
    (1) 变异率
    (2) 选择阈值
    (3) 抗体生命周期
    (4) 误差
    (5) 解群体的规模

    本文已影响
    最近关注
    0基础免费学PLC,扫描观看

    扫描上方二维码免费观看PLC视频课程